From 295b7354d92e6a8be7fd52a47175a83bac747659 Mon Sep 17 00:00:00 2001 From: CatChow0 Date: Fri, 10 Oct 2025 17:16:10 +0200 Subject: [PATCH] Patch - Improves camera controls and movement. - V14.5.33 Refactors camera input handling for smoother and more intuitive control. This change introduces a dedicated CameraInput structure and updates the camera class to use it for movement and rotation based on user input. It removes the old position class camera related logic and integrates mouse delta for precise rotation control and scroll wheel for speed adjustments.
